什么是认证物品?

含义

认证物品是指其真伪已由认可的、公认的第三方实体验证的收藏品或转售商品。这种验证是一个正式声明,表明该物品不是假货、仿制品或复制品。对于普通市场而言,这相当于一份经过公证的来源保证。在收藏领域,这种保证减轻了高价值二级市场购买的主要风险:欺诈。认证过程根据既定的行业标准确认了物品的来源和材料的完整性。

对价格的影响

认证直接转化为价格溢价,充当了买方的风险降低因素。具有既定认证的物品会带来价格上涨,通常比同等未经验证的市场价值高出 15% 到 50%,具体取决于物品的稀有程度和认证机构的声誉。例如,一件需求量大的认证古董手表,如果认证来自全球公认的服务机构,其售价可能比同款未经验证的物品高出 500 美元。低端物品的溢价较小,可能只有 5-10%。

如何识别

认证是通过文件来验证的,而不仅仅是物品本身。请寻找由第三方出具的官方真品证书 (COA) 或鉴定报告。这些文件必须包含与实物相匹配的唯一物品标识符。常见的陷阱是卖家将一份通用、自行生成的“保证”当作官方认证——这是无效的。对于电子产品或设计师商品,请仔细核对序列号是否与证书相符。假货通常无法匹配文件中详细说明的特定批次或生产批次。

明智购买

当物品的市场价值超过某个门槛(通常是 500 美元 USD),或者当物品极易被仿冒时(例如奢侈手袋、限量版运动鞋),为认证支付溢价是合理的。如果物品价值较低,认证成本可能会超过潜在的利润空间。一个公平的交易是认证成本被计入最终售价,而不是在已经虚高的价格之上额外加价。如果卖家要求的溢价远高于认证本身的成本,则需要进行进一步的审查。

明智出售

在刊登时,有效且可转移的认证文件是主要的价值驱动因素。一个明确写着“包含 [认证机构名称] COA”的列表,会立即将该物品提升到未经验证的列表之上。列表中最有效的要素是实际 COA 的高分辨率照片,照片需清晰显示物品的唯一标识符和认证机构的印章。这会将买方的认知从“风险评估”转变为“已验证的获取”,从而可以应用溢价定价结构。
